Transaction 508b46e2ecea472e6013a5f20147aee9b6f995a53cfa11895cfd0726828ea093

1 Input
2 Outputs
  • 508b46e2ecea472e6013a5f20147aee9b6f995a53cfa11895cfd0726828ea093:0
  • value  17293259
    address  1496iBRT3Dq1BFuC5a1ZTBNbc4YwZbN1yj
  • 508b46e2ecea472e6013a5f20147aee9b6f995a53cfa11895cfd0726828ea093:1
  • value  128566847
    address  1BhvYLc969mkCfCJ2APZwEGCmBbnNd7FA4